OTD - January 25, 1863
At a 10 am meeting with Generals Burnside and Halleck, President Lincoln makes the decision to replace Burnside with General Joseph Hooker. This comes about after the disaster at the Battle of Fredericksburg and then Burnside's infamous Mud March.
